Construction work example
In construction projects, efficiency is very important. For example, if one group of workers can build a wall in 5 days and another group takes 10 days, the first group is more efficient. Builders use this information to plan work and complete projects on time.
Contractors often calculate how many workers are needed to complete a project within a deadline. By understanding efficiency, they can assign the right number of workers and manage time properly.
This is a direct example of how efficiency affects work completion in real life.
Factory production example
In factories, efficiency is used to measure how quickly machines or workers produce goods. For example, if one machine produces 100 items in an hour and another produces 50 items, the first machine is more efficient.
Factory managers use efficiency to improve production rates and reduce costs. They try to increase efficiency by using better machines, improving skills, and reducing waste.
This helps industries grow and meet demand quickly.
